![](https://img-blog.csdnimg.cn/20201014180756928.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Spring
596506678
也许是对的
展开
-
springAOP jdk动态代理学习笔记
springAOP jdk动态代理申明式事务是通过AOP实现的;如果要通知一个对象,但是对象没有被Spring管理,就用AspectJ;如果对象是Spring管理的,用Spring AOP ;AspectJ是静态织入;在编译的时候织入;Spring AOP 是动态织入;在运行的时候织入;https://blog.csdn.net/java_lyvee/category_7351027.html...原创 2021-02-21 12:48:58 · 137 阅读 · 0 评论 -
AOP各种表达式,自定义注解笔记
AOP各种表达式,aspectj的关系xml主要用来描述数据;自定义注解:1.要指定注解使用的位置。使用源注解@Target, ElementType2.注解有生命周期。自定义的注解默认只存在源码。 @Retention(RetentionPolicy.RUNTIME)这样写虚拟机执行的时候就会被发掘。3.获取注解值得示例:Class clazz = Strudent.getClass();//判断是否有注解@Entityif(clazz.isAnnotationPresent(Enity.原创 2021-02-19 22:50:39 · 491 阅读 · 0 评论 -
SpringIOC笔记
构造器出初始化后默认执行init方法:写法:@PostConstructpublic void init(){…}销毁时默认执行方法:写法:@PreDestroypubllic void destroy(){… }Spring循环引用,A、B两个类相互引用。类之间可以循环引用;默认的single模式,可以先相互引用。因为缓存。但是,如果把类Scope设置成原型模式,就不能相互引用了。@profile注解。@profile注解是spring提供的一个用来标明当前运行环境的注解。我们正原创 2021-02-18 22:32:56 · 85 阅读 · 0 评论 -
spring IOC笔记,@Autowired 与@Resource
spring IOC笔记,@Autowired 与@Resource控制反转(Inversion of Control,缩写为IoC),是面向对象编程中的一种设计原则,可以用来减低计算机代码之间的耦合度。其中最常见的方式叫做依赖注入(Dependency Injection,简称DI),还有一种方式叫“依赖查找”(Dependency Lookup)spring编程的风格schemal-based-------xmlannotation-based-----annotationjava-based原创 2021-02-18 19:55:10 · 107 阅读 · 0 评论